From what I can gather in speaking to Eric & Russ at Stitches it is not uncommon for the Mets to send Stitches jerseys from previous years to get customized for a current player if they are in need of a jersey. Charlie Samuels has an inventory of jerseys in various sizes that he keeps at Shea. Whenever he needs a jersey right away he finds one in the right size and has it customized the year tag on the jersey is not something that he worries about, as long as the jersey is the right size it is getting done. Stitches has customized jerseys for the Mets with previous years tags on them as well as jerseys that had no year tags on them at all.

That jersey was most likely customized by Stitches, it has the same arch in the name placement that they use when they customize jerseys unlike the jerseys customized by Majestic that are almost straight across the back. It is difficult to 100% verify that jersey because the Mets did not have an agreement with Steiner and MLB did not authenticate jerseys with the numbered stickers until 2005. (I think that is when they started)

Everything points to that being legit (Gray Flannel COA Leyland's auction picture, Eric and Russ's opinion and verification of the year tag possibly being used in 2004) but a photomatch would be the only way to seal the deal. I checked Getty but they only have one picture of Wright in a road jersey in 2004 in a game against the Giants and the picture does not show the front or the back of the jersey.
